Types of Free Online Poker Games

Online poker platforms typically offer several ways to play for free, each with its own set of features and benefits. Understanding these options can help you choose the format that best suits your interests.

Play Money Poker

The most common form of free online poker is play money poker. Here, you receive a virtual bankroll to use at tables and tournaments. While you can’t cash out winnings, play money chips are usually replenished daily or through in-game achievements, allowing for endless play.

Freeroll Tournaments

Freerolls are tournaments that require no entry fee but often offer real prizes, such as cash, merchandise, or tickets to larger events. These are ideal for players looking to experience the excitement of competitive poker without financial risk.

No-Download Poker Games

Many sites provide instant-play poker directly in your web browser. These no-download options are convenient and accessible, requiring only an internet connection. They’re perfect for quick sessions or when you’re using a shared computer.

Poker Apps and Social Poker

Mobile apps and social poker games, often found on platforms like Facebook or dedicated poker apps, focus on play money games and community features. These are designed for casual play and social interaction, with leaderboards, achievements, and in-game rewards.

Popular Free Poker Variants

Not all poker games are the same, and free online poker platforms typically offer a variety of options. Here are some of the most popular variants you can expect to find:

  • Texas Hold’em: The most widely played poker variant, Texas Hold’em is easy to learn and available on virtually every platform. Its simple rules and strategic depth make it a favourite for free play.
  • Omaha: Known for its action-packed gameplay, Omaha is another staple of free poker sites. The game uses four hole cards and often results in bigger pots and more complex strategies.
  • Seven Card Stud: While less common than Hold’em or Omaha, Seven Card Stud remains popular among traditionalists and is available on select platforms.
  • Draw Poker: Variants like Five Card Draw are accessible and fun, especially for those seeking a break from the more common community card games.
  • Spin & Go and Sit & Go: These fast-paced tournament formats are available in play money versions, providing quick and exciting games for players on the go.

How Free Online Poker Works

Understanding how free poker games operate can enhance your experience and help you make the most of the available features. Here’s a step-by-step breakdown of what to expect:

Account Creation

Most platforms require you to create an account, even for free play. This process typically involves providing an email address and creating a username. Some social poker apps let you start playing instantly through your social media profile.

Choosing a Game

Once registered, you can browse available tables and tournaments. Filters allow you to select by game type, stakes (in play money), and number of players. Many platforms recommend tables suited to your experience level.

Receiving Play Money Chips

Upon joining, you’ll receive a starting balance of play money chips. These are used to buy into games and tournaments. If you run out, most sites offer free daily top-ups or allow you to earn more through gameplay achievements.

Playing the Game

Gameplay follows the standard rules of poker, with betting, folding, raising, and all the usual actions. The main difference is that chips have no real-world value, so you can practice strategies and try bold moves without financial risk.

Community and Social Features

Free poker sites often include chat functions, friend lists, leaderboards, and achievements. These features are designed to foster a sense of community and make the experience more engaging.

Comparing Free Poker to Real Money Poker

While free poker is a fantastic way to learn and enjoy the game, there are some key differences compared to real money play. Understanding these can help you set realistic expectations and decide when you might want to transition to higher-stakes games.

  • Player Behaviour: In free poker games, players tend to be more experimental and less cautious, as there’s no real money at stake. This can lead to looser games and unexpected hands.
  • Game Selection: Free poker platforms typically offer a wide selection of variants, but some niche formats may only be available in real money rooms.
  • Skill Development: Free poker is excellent for learning the basics and practicing strategies, but transitioning to real money games can introduce new dynamics, such as bluffing and bankroll management.
  • Prize Opportunities: While play money games don’t offer cash prizes, freeroll tournaments can provide real-world rewards without an entry fee.
